Veterans comprising former members of “160 Squadron” who had flown ‘B 24 Liberator, Bombers’ from Ratmalana, Sigiriya, Kankasanthurai, Minneriya as well as China Bay during World war Two, visited the Sri Lanka Air Force Museum  Ratmalana today (30th March 2010).The contingent was made up of 12 veterans, 02 widows of veterans, 04 wives and others. Helitours the largest & premier domestic air service in Sri Lanka, operated by the SLAF, completed its 200th flight on the 24th March 2010 since resumption of operations last year. Helitours resumed its operations on the 21st of July last year after the successful conclusion of the "humanitarian operations".
